ユーザーコントロールのascx( "view")とascx.cs( "controller")の部分を区切ることは可能ですか?私は、プロジェクト間でビュー部分が変更されている間に、コントローラ部分をApp_Codeに移動して再表示するのが好きですか?ASP.NET/UserControls:「コントローラ」を「ビュー」からどのように分離できますか?
1
A
答えて
2
はい、あなたは分離コードとascxファイルを分離しても、通常のASP.NETで、そのクラスに
<%@ Control
Language = "C#"
Inherits = "Project.Business.Service.MyControl"
%>
2
を継承するユーザーコントロールを拡張し、あなたた.ascxファイル内の一部のサービスクラスの分離コードを書きます彼らはまだ密接に結合しています。それは本当の "コントローラ"(ビューとは別に)ではありません。
この純度が必要な場合は、(明らかに)異なる方法でこれを扱うASP.NET MVCを検討してください。
関連する問題
- 1. インターフェイスビルダーを使用せずにコントローラからビューを分離する方法
- 2. エンティティをデータベースモデルからどのように分離するのですか?
- 3. どのようにしてRazor Viewsを分離できますか?
- 4. レンダリング他のコントローラから部分ビュー
- 5. Ember.js:コントローラからビューを切り離すにはどうすればいいですか?
- 6. ビューはどのように分かれていますか?
- 7. コントローラでどのように機能をテストできますか?
- 8. TomcatコンテキストからJDBC分離レベルを設定できますか?
- 9. コントローラの依存関係をどのように切り離すことができますか?
- 10. NON MVC Webアプリケーションでビュー/コントローラをどのように整理しますか?
- 11. Yii:ビューから、どのように変数がどこから来たのか分かりましたか?
- 12. EmberJS:モデル、ストア、コントローラ、複雑なアプリケーションのビューの良い分離?
- 13. ExtJsのコントローラとビューを切り離す
- 14. コントローラからリスト<MyModel>を自分のビューに戻すことはできますか? (MVC3)
- 15. JSにPHP変数が必要な場合、どうすればJavaScriptからPHPを分離できますか?
- 16. GLSLでポイントからラインセグメントまでの距離をどのように実装できますか?
- 17. adapternパターンを実装することでfatインターフェイスをどのように分離できますか?
- 18. Clojureはどのように問題の分離を起こすのですか?
- 19. ビューとコントローラを分割するとき
- 20. 別のコントローラからビュー内にビューを表示するにはどうすればいいですか?
- 21. モデル/コントローラがありますが、どのようにビューを処理できますか?
- 22. ASP.net MVC 2メインDLLをどのように分離するのですか?
- 23. タブの見出しをanglejsで体から分離するにはどうすればよいですか?
- 24. spring mvcでオブジェクトをビューからコントローラに渡すにはどうすればよいですか?
- 25. ビューで複数のモデル/コントローラからデータにアクセスするにはどうすればよいですか?
- 26. ajaxリクエストを使用して、春のコントローラからビューを返すにはどうすればよいですか?
- 27. Asp.net MVC 5のコントローラからビュー内のメニューを操作するにはどうすればよいですか?
- 28. CodeigniterのビューからコントローラのURLを取得するにはどうすればよいですか?
- 29. SVGアイコンに移動する - コードからどのように分離するのですか?
- 30. Android:どのようにコードをスタイルから分離する必要がありますか?
どのようにそのコントロールの子コントロールを参照しますか? –
.ascxファイルにコントロールがある場合 コントロールコードで保護されたラベルmyLabelを定義し、次にmyLabel.Text = "x"を設定します。 –
Spikolynn